The Boeing Supplier Management team is seeking an Entry /Associate Level Procurement Agent to join the team in Saint Louis, MO. This position will focus on supporting the Boeing Global Services BGS Supply Chain.
The successful candidate will have an exciting opportunity to join the Supply Chain Contracts Team supporting Boeing Global Services - Government (BGS-G) as a Procurement Agent. The role performs continuous review and analysis of demand and supply, prepares and executes proprietary information agreements, and supports sourcing strategies, negotiations, and documentation of contracts and agreements. The candidate will communicate performance expectations and metrics to evaluate and monitor supplier performance; integrate program, customer, product, aftermarket, and in-service strategies into source selection, negotiation, and contracting approaches; negotiate pricing and contract terms and conditions; prepare and execute negotiated contractual documents and binding agreements; and conduct risk, issues, and opportunities management.
Position Responsibilities:
- Prepare, review, and execute negotiated contractual documents and binding agreements, ensuring compliance with company policies, regulations, and contract governance, and maintaining audit readiness.
- Lead source-selection activities, engaging cross-functional stakeholders (program, engineering, finance, legal) to drive supplier selection based on cost, technical capability, risk, and schedule.
- Manage supplier and subcontractor performance, relationships, and development initiatives to ensure on-time delivery, quality, financial stability, and strong performance.
- Proactively mitigate risk through contract clauses, contingency planning, supplier risk assessments, and rapid issue escalation and resolution to protect program schedule and budget.
- Negotiate pricing, terms, and conditions for contracts.
